A CHARLES X ORMOLU, MOTHER-OF-PEARL AND ENAMELLED 'PALAIS ROYALE' FLACON DE TOILETTE, IN THE FORM OF A MINIATURE HORSE-DRAWN FIRE-PUMP CARRIAGE
EARLY 19TH CENTURY, POSSIBLY FOR THE AUSTRIAN OR RUSSIAN MARKET
The rectangular body with hinged flaps enclosing two cylinders with pistons, one side with an urn, the side panels with ovals depicting birds and flowers surrounded by ribbon-tied foliage, one end with an oval panel depicting an heraldic double-headed eagle, the other end depicting birds surrounded by stars, on four wheels and with a carriage axle, with ladder
4¾ in. (12 cm.) high; 8 in. (20 cm.) long; 2¾ in. (7 cm.) deep
